Output 825907d62150f4796c9bfe4a6605f1696d95a28dc5cc76433ac7da9ee6600029:1

value
41568000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55833818c05105d96f5b12e2c47164a73f072444 OP_EQUALVERIFY OP_CHECKSIG
address
18o9da5sPdNTrhHTMj8icdFrRajHRsoa1p
transaction
825907d62150f4796c9bfe4a6605f1696d95a28dc5cc76433ac7da9ee6600029
spent
true